Ticket: Staging env misconfigured for Siftgate bloom filter

The bloom layer in front of the Pellet KV store is rejecting all lookups in staging because the env file was copied from the dev template without credentials. False-positive tuning values are fine; only the auth line is missing. To unblock the weekly demo, the Pellet admission secret must be set on the following line.

env line for yaguf-fajop: LEDGER_TOKEN13=fb08984397349

**Mgmt Meeting Minutes — Retiring the Brightline Range**

Quick recap for sales leads at Fenholt Supplies: we agreed to retire the Brightline fixture range by year-end. Remaining stock moves to clearance pricing next month, and accounts on standing orders get migrated to the Lumetta range. Trade-in incentives were approved in principle. The confidential note on next steps sits just below.

board note of bajof-bajeg: The pricing group signed off on a budget of $13.4 million for Project Sildor. The renewal with Lamixek Holdings closes at $48.9 million a year, 49 percent above the last contract.

## Deployment notes — Wirebloom relay

Heads up, support folks: Wirebloom ships with websocket permessage-deflate enabled by default. It saves bandwidth for chatty dashboards but chews CPU on small, frequent frames, so mobile-heavy tenants sometimes see latency complaints. Before escalating a "slow updates" ticket, check whether compression is on for that pod. The deployed defaults are shown below.

deployment values, bahop-yadug:
[caswyn]
port = 8443
region = east-4
host = caswyn.lumicworks.internal
timeout_ms = 5000
retries = 8

MEMO — Kettling Depot Receiving

Uniform sets for the new Kettling depot arrive Wednesday via Ashgrove courier: 40 boxes, sorted by size, manifest attached to box one. Check the count at the dock before signing; shortages go straight to stores, not the courier. The hand-over instruction the courier will follow is set out below.

drop instructions, tafof-baguf: the holmir gilox courier leaves the sormir ulaok holdor ledger at gate 5596 under passcode 257343

Hey — handing over the pager for the week. Restockly, the vending-machine restock planner, had a hiccup Tuesday where route generation stalled on the Fennbrook depot data; I restarted the planner worker and it cleared. Watch for repeat stalls after the nightly inventory sync around 02:00. If it happens twice in a row, loop in the depot integrations lead at the address below.

escalation mailbox, hadug-bajog: sormir@norvalabs.internal